    MCI tells brokers, jewelers: Register on MoFA alert system by July 31

    The Ministry of Commerce and Trade has known as on actual property brokers and valuable metals sellers to register with the automated alert system of the Ministry of Overseas Affairs, which tracks updates to worldwide sanctions lists associated to counterterrorism and the financing of arms proliferation.

    In an announcement, the ministry emphasised that the deadline for registration is July 31, warning that failure to conform will end in monetary penalties in accordance with related authorized provisions, experiences Al-Rai each day.

    The alert system is a part of Kuwait’s broader dedication to adhering to worldwide requirements on combating cash laundering, terrorism financing, and arms proliferation, and goals to make sure that companies are stored knowledgeable in actual time about related updates to sanctions lists.

    The ministry urged all involved events to behave rapidly and full the obligatory registration to keep away from regulatory violations and potential authorized penalties.
